How to identify WHICH SPECIFIC TAB is using high CPU? No tab info/description shows in Windows Task Manager.

Task Manager detail line can be expanded to show multiple open tabs, and I can sort display by CPU but that doesn't help me identify WHICH SPECIFIC tab is using high CPU. Are there any tools to help me quickly identify (and perhaps End) such high CPU tabs/processes? Thanks!

Enter about:processes in the address bar to find it.
